Investing for Everyone. 1. Do an Inventory of Your Assets. The first step in turning $100,000 into $1 million is to gauge whether or not you have $100,000 as a reasonable starting point. This amount should be free and clear of any major debts you have or taxes you owe.

After investing for 10 years at 5% interest, your initial investment of $100,000 will have grown to $162,889 . You will have earned $62,889 in interest. Jun 5, 2021 · ETFs are often index-funds that try to match the return of an index such as gold or the S&P 500. For example, SPY is the most famous index fund that tracks the S&P500 Index. Vanguard also offers many low-cost index ETFs to choose from. People who invest 100k in this ETF get instant diversification across 500 companies.

You need to make at least $100,000 a year if you want a six-figure income. That means making at least: $8,333.33 a month, or. $2,083.33 a week, or. $416.66 each workday, or. $52 an hour.
